If you can teach her flash cards of H & V, she will pick it up. Make big ones & have her trace the letters with her finger. Another trick is to use the number of lines in each letter to mimic the number of syllables in each word.
I-I ..hora zon tul \ / .. ver tical
This stuff works, I promise. I had a 3 yr reciting her vowels before she even knew her abc's. It's all about creating little tricks & games for them. They fill in the rest.
